The significance of beta-catenin, E-cadherin, and P-cadherin expressions in neoplastic progression of colorectal mucosa: an immunohistochemical study.

Abstract

BACKGROUND AND STUDY AIMS

The purpose of the current study was to investigate the role of beta-catenin, E-cadherin and P-cadherin in colorectal carcinogenesis using tissue array method.

PATIENTS AND METHODS

Core tissue biopsies were taken from paraffin-embedded tissue blocks of 167 cases including 26 normal mucosae (NM), 99 colorectal polyps (10 hyperplastic polyps (HP), 8 traditional serrated (TSA), 17 tubular (TA), 37 tubulovillous (TVA), and 27 villous adenomas (VA)), 14 adenomas with intramucosal carcinoma (ACA), and 28 colorectal cancers (CCA). Immunohistochemistry was performed using antibodies to beta-catenin, E-cadherin, and P-cadherin. Distribution of positivity was assessed using percentage expression while an arbitrary grading scale was used for staining intensity.

RESULTS

beta-catenin expression was cytoplasmic, membranous, and nuclear. Both E-cadherin and P-cadherin expressions were confined to cytoplasmic-membranous compartments. Membranous expression of beta-catenin significantly decreased in CCA (p < 0.01). Nuclear beta-catenin expression significantly increased in close correlation with neoplastic sequence reaching its highest expression in ACA and CCA (p < 0.001). Polyps with intraepithelial neoplasia (IEN) showed significantly higher nuclear beta-catenin expression in parallel with increasing grades of IEN (p < 0.001). E-cadherin and P-cadherin expression increased in polyps, whereas a significant decrease in their expression was observed in CCA (p < 0.001) while E-cadherin expression significantly increased in CCA compared to NM (p < 0.001), no such difference was observed in P-cadherin expression.

CONCLUSIONS

Nuclear beta-catenin expression correlating with the grade of IEN in polyps and carcinomas supports its role in colorectal carcinogenesis. E-cadherin and P-cadherin expressions in adenomas suggest that these molecules might have role in adenoma formation though not necessarily be involved in neoplastic progression.

摘要

背景与研究目的

本研究旨在采用组织芯片法探讨β-连环蛋白、E-钙黏蛋白和P-钙黏蛋白在结直肠癌发生中的作用。

患者与方法

从167例石蜡包埋组织块中获取核心组织活检标本,包括26例正常黏膜(NM)、99例结直肠息肉(10例增生性息肉(HP)、8例传统锯齿状腺瘤(TSA)、17例管状腺瘤(TA)、37例管状绒毛状腺瘤(TVA)和27例绒毛状腺瘤(VA))、14例伴黏膜内癌的腺瘤(ACA)以及28例结直肠癌(CCA)。采用抗β-连环蛋白、E-钙黏蛋白和P-钙黏蛋白的抗体进行免疫组织化学检测。使用阳性表达百分比评估阳性分布情况,同时使用任意分级量表评估染色强度。

结果

β-连环蛋白表达于细胞质、细胞膜和细胞核。E-钙黏蛋白和P-钙黏蛋白表达均局限于细胞质-细胞膜区域。β-连环蛋白的细胞膜表达在CCA中显著降低(p < 0.01)。细胞核β-连环蛋白表达显著增加,与肿瘤发生序列密切相关,在ACA和CCA中表达最高(p < 0.001)。伴有上皮内瘤变(IEN)的息肉中,细胞核β-连环蛋白表达显著升高,且与IEN分级增加平行(p < 0.001)。息肉中E-钙黏蛋白和P-钙黏蛋白表达增加,而在CCA中其表达显著降低(p < 0.001),与NM相比,CCA中E-钙黏蛋白表达显著增加(p < 0.001),P-钙黏蛋白表达未观察到此类差异。

结论

细胞核β-连环蛋白表达与息肉和癌中IEN分级相关,支持其在结直肠癌发生中的作用。腺瘤中E-钙黏蛋白和P-钙黏蛋白表达表明这些分子可能在腺瘤形成中起作用,但不一定参与肿瘤进展。
